I first started going here about 2 months ago for a pokemon prerelease event. As it was my first time playing in person I was pretty nervous. But when I arrived the staff was super helpful, friendly and knowledgeable. They made the event super easy and fun. I started going on Fridays and Saturdays for their league and free play events and was pleasantly surprised to learn that they give away free prize packs just for playing. I started bringing my family recently and they helped teach my daughter how to play on saturday morning at their weekly learn to play event. If your looking for a family friendly atmosphere and a fun place to play pokemon I couldn't recommend them more!

Went in to buy some Pokemon cards for my nephew because you cant seem to find them anywhere else. I was greeted by a friendly cashier and was super helpful with anything i asked. I went to purchase a ETB for my nephew (Retails $50) and they were selling for $66. When purchasing the cashier informed me she would have to rip the seal on the box. When i asked her why she said “Bosses decision no sealed product leaves the store”. If this is the case i would not come to this shop. Selling items for more than retail then telling me i cant keep it sealed is extremely asinine. Will not be coming back :(
